Are there such thing as powerful charts? If so, what’s a powerful chart?

This phrase is used by astrologers, but in the end it is often a value judgment. See below. A powerful chart can take many forms. One is to have many planets in your dominion or exaltation and those planets ruling the angles and/or in them, or some of them. Another way is to have these planets very well positioned, say in the MC or ASC.

A powerful planet is a planet that is in a good sign (for that planet), above the horizon, moving straight ahead, fast (i.e. traveling faster than its average speed in its orbit ), in a good or angular house, not applying an unfavorable aspect to evil ones and applying a favorable aspect to beneficent ones. It may be impossible for a planet to have all favorable conditions on a map (or unfavorable conditions), but having some of them makes a planet powerful.

That said, I will quote two charts that make us pass Hmmmmm. General George S Patton has a bad picture in every way, and he has achieved a lot in his life. He had a lot to overcome. At the other extreme I have a graphic in my files of a man who has almost every planet in great dignity and let’s be nice and say he hasn’t done much with his life until here. Strength or weakness shows how difficult or easy things can be, but it is up to the individual to overcome or set a direction and work with the chart to have a successful life.
